Titulli në përmbajtje në PHP
Është shumë më e përshtatshme të ruash titullin e faqes në të njëjtin vend ku është përmbajtja e saj. Për këtë, në skedarin e përmbajtjes mund të krijosh një komandë që përcakton titullin e kësaj faqeje.
Për shembull, mund të bësh kështu:
{{ title: "page 1 title" }}
<div>
content 1
</div>
Le të bëjmë që motori para se të futë përmbajtjen të nxjerrë prej saj titullin dhe ta fusë atë në vendin e duhur të shabllonit.
Për fillim, le të marrim titullin nga teksti i përmbajtjes:
<?php
preg_match('#\{\{ title: "(.+?)" \}\}#', $content, $match);
$title = $match[1];
?>
Tani, në tekstin e përmbajtjes, le të heqim komandën që nuk na nevojitet më, në mënyrë që ajo të mos shfaqet në tekstin e faqes:
<?php
$content = preg_replace('#\{\{ title: "(.+?)" \}\}#', '', $content);
?>
Implementoni në motorin tuaj titujt që ruhen në përmbajtjen e faqes.